What are some common challenges faced in a Back Office Operation role, and how can they be addressed?

Back Office Operation professionals often encounter challenges such as managing large volumes of data, maintaining accuracy under tight deadlines, and coordinating effectively with front office and other departments. To address these, it's important to develop str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and clear communication abilities. Many teams use workflow management software and regular process reviews to streamline tasks and minimize errors. Staying adaptable and proactive in learning internal systems also helps ensure smooth operations and career growth.

What are back office operations?

Back office operations refer to the administrative and support functions within a company that are not client-facing. These tasks include accounting, human resources, IT, record maintenance, compliance, and data management. While they do not directly interact with customers, back office operations are essential for ensuring that the business runs smoothly and efficiently. Employees in these roles help process transactions, maintain records, and support the core business activities.

Job Description :
Your Job:
The Back Office Coordinator will assist the Office Manager with Operation and Management job duties and responsibilities for facilities with 5 or more Physicians.
Your Job Requirements:
โ€ข Strong communication skills with consistent incorporation of judgement and discretion.
โ€ข Previous minimum of 2 years in a back office within a medical setting or two years nursing experience.
Your Job Responsibilities:
โ€ข Maintain the strictest confidentiality; performs all Medical Assistant duties as required.
โ€ข Assist the Office Manager in developing and implementing clinical policies and procedures.
โ€ข Advise Office Manager of problems and concerns in the facility and participate in problem solving.
โ€ข Advise and delegate duties to back office staff members as assigned.
โ€ข Monitors education certifications of nursing staff to assure legislative compliance.
โ€ข Responsible for pharmaceutical handling system upgrade and compliance.
โ€ข Schedule monthly back office staff meetings.
โ€ข Assists with problems in diagnostic and procedural coding.
โ€ข Attends meetings and performs other duties as assigned by the Office Manager.
โ€ข Assists in care and upkeep of department equipment and supplies, including calibration and record keeping in accordance with current policy and procedures.
โ€ข Complete projects assigned by Office Manager in a timely and effective manner.
โ€ข Participates in interviewing applicants and provides information to Office Manager for hiring decisions and employee performance evaluations.
โ€ข Trains MAs and others, serves as a resource to other clinical STAFFnd maintains training and orientation material for MA's and others.
โ€ข Participates in continuing education and other appropriate activities to maintain professional competence.
โ€ข Performs lead duties for back-office staff to ensure optimal patient flow and excellent customer service in accordance with company policies, practices and procedures. Works with other staff members to foster a team approach to achieve the highest quality of patient care and staff cooperation. Supports the clinic efficiency and cohesion.
โ€ข Follows established policies and procedures.
